Produktbeschreibung
A classic study of naval strategy and tactics during the American Revolutionary War, written by a renowned naval historian and theorist. The book analyzes the British and American fleets' strengths and weaknesses, their evolving doctrines, and the key battles that shaped the outcome of the conflict. Mahan's insights into the role of sea power in modern warfare influenced generations of military leaders and policymakers. Military history enthusiasts, sailors, and strategists will appreciate this authoritative work.
